The Skokie Heritage Museum

A recently completed restoration of Skokie's first public building has yielded a gallery of Skokie's past. Explore Skokie's heritage when visiting the Historic Engine House and orginal Log Cabin, built in 1847

Emily Oaks Nature Center

Emily Oaks Nature Center is a 13-acre nature preserve located in the heart of Skokie. This unique site is restoring the remnants of an oak savannah with walking trails, a pond and nature center.

Holocaust Memorial Foundation

The Holocaust Memorial Foundation of Illinois provides year-round educational outreach to defend and preserve the value and dignity of human life through remembrance of the events surrounding the Nazi Holocaust of the Jews from 1933 to 1945
